Petition to the House of Commons in Parliament assembled

Whereas:
  • Former SNC-Lavalin CEO Pierre Duhaime has pleaded guilty to a charge of helping a public servant commit breach of trust;
  • SNC-Lavalin is currently facing prosecution for bribing public officials in Libya; and
  • Allegations have been publicly leveled that Canada's Attorney General was pressured by members of the Prime Minister's Office to intervene in the prosecution of SNC-Lavalin.
We, the undersigned, residents of Canada, call upon the Government of Canada to immediately establish a Public Commission to investigate : (a) whether individuals at the highest levels of government sought to obstruct, influence, or interfere in the prosecution of SNC-Lavalin; (b) whether or not those individuals received bribes to obstruct, influence, or interfere in the prosecution of SNC-Lavalin; (c) to determine what knowledge any elected officials had of any efforts to obstruct, influence, or interfere in the prosecution of SNC-Lavalin; and (d) to determine whether or not the recent removal of Jody Wilson-Raybould from the position of Attorney General was undertaken as punishment for refusing to participate in any effort to obstruct, influence, or interfere in the prosecution of SNC-Lavalin.
